Dihydrexidine (hydrochloride)
- CAS Number: 137417-08-4
- UNSPSC Description: Dihydrexidine hydrochloride (DAR-0100 hydrochloride) is a high potent, selective and full efficacy D1-like dopamine receptor (D1/D5) agonist, with an IC50 of 10 nM for D1 receptor. Dihydrexidine hydrochloride exhibits potent antiparkinsonian activity[1][2][3][4]. Dihydrexidine hydrochloride can stimulate YAP phosphorylation[5].
